Does the Power of Attorney Expire? POA in Dubai, UAE
Yes, a Power of Attorney (POA) can expire. It depends on what’s written in the document. If there’s a date in the paper, it will end on that date. If there’s no date, it may last until the job is done or until the person cancels it. What Is a Power of Attorney? A...
